Abstract

A bidirectional buffering deburring machine is characterized by comprising a motor, a cardan joint, an axial buffering coil, a rotary shaft, a buffering glue spiral spring sleeve, a dust cover, a torsion limiting coupler, a fixing round board, a bearing bush, a tool bit and a machine shell; the motor, the cardan joint, the axial buffering coil, the fixing round board and the bearing bush are located inside the machine shell; the bottom end of the motor is connected with the cardan joint; the rotary shaft is connected to the upper end of the motor through a spline and connected with the tool bit through the torsion limiting coupler; the buffering glue spiral spring sleeve is located on the outer side of the machine shell, arranged on the rotary shaft in a sleeving mode and fixedly connected with the machine shell; the buffering glue spiral spring sleeve is provided with the dust cover; the dust cover is located between the buffering glue spiral spring sleeve and the torsion limiting coupler. The buffering effect of the whole device can be automatically adjusted, intelligent buffering is achieved, the buffering performance of the mechanical deburring device is improved, and the deburring effect is better.

technical field [0001] The invention belongs to the field of mechanical processing, and in particular relates to a two-way buffer deburring machine arranged at the end of a manipulator. Background technique [0002] Most of the existing mechanical deburring devices use one-way buffering devices, such as radial buffering or axial buffering, which have certain flexibility, but as an important part of advanced manufacturing technology, it must be suitable for deburring of various parts. The flexibility of the deburring device at the end of the manipulator cannot meet the needs of complex situations, resulting in easy damage to the manipulator, tool or parts, which will have an adverse effect on the deburring operation. Therefore, measures need to be taken to improve the buffering of the deburring device in the mechanical area sex.
